A set of 10 categories of services health insurance plans must cover under the Affordable Care Act. These include doctors’ services, inpatient and outpatient hospital care, prescription drug coverage, pregnancy and childbirth, mental health services, and more. Some plans cover more services. ACA-compliant plans cover mental health care as one of 10 essential benefits, along with preventive services and maternity care. This means that if you enroll in an ACA-compliant plan, you will have mental health coverage. Your state psychological association may be another source of potential names. California: If the healthcare plan provides physical treatment coverage, it must also provide mental treatment coverage, including ABA therapy. Colorado: ABA therapy is covered with no coverage limit. Delaware: ABA therapy is covered up to $36,000 per year. Comparing plans can help you lower your costs. ABA therapy costs $62,400 to $249,600 per year without insurance coverage. The monthly costs for ABA therapy can range from $4,800 to over $20,000 per month without insurance coverage.
